PMO Manager
Department: Project Management Office / Program Management
Job Summary:
The PMO Manager is responsible for leading the Project Management Office and ensuring that projects across the organization are delivered on time, within scope, and budget. This role involves developing and implementing project management frameworks, enforcing governance, and supporting project managers in achieving strategic objectives.
Key Responsibilities:
- Establish and maintain PMO frameworks, methodologies, and best practices across all projects and programs.
- Monitor project performance and provide status reporting to executive leadership.
- Oversee project portfolio management including planning, prioritization, and resource allocation.
- Ensure compliance with project governance standards and risk management policies.
- Provide guidance, mentorship, and support to project managers and cross-functional teams.
- Facilitate project reviews, audits, and lessons learned sessions.
- Manage PMO tools, templates, and dashboards for effective project tracking and reporting.
- Collaborate with stakeholders to align projects with business goals and strategic initiatives.
- Drive continuous improvement in project delivery processes.
